America's leading small business
association has slammed Barack Obama for showing 'an utter lack of
understanding' of the country's entrepreneurs when he told them: 'If
you've got a business - you didn't build that. Somebody else made that
happen.'
In a hard-hitting
statement to Mail Online, the National Federation of Independent
Businesses (NFIB) president Dan Danne said: 'What a disappointment to
hear President Obama's revealing comments challenging the significance
of America's entrepreneurs.
Mr
Danne added: 'His unfortunate remarks over the weekend show an utter
lack of understanding and appreciation for the people who take a huge
personal risk and work endless hours to start a business and create
jobs.'
